3.0 out of 5 stars Well built thermometer, but understand its limitations., December 8, 2011
This review is from: MasterBuilt 23102009 Butterball 12-Inch Stainless Steel Deep Fry Thermometer (Lawn & Patio)
Well built thermometer, but understand its limitations. This model covers from 100 to 500 deg. F. Therefore don't anticipate accurate readings in a narrow range. For "smoking", many consider 200 - 225 to be an ideal temp range, so a 150 to 400 deg F unit will be far easier to use; Amazon doesn't list one. For deep frying, the same smaller range will be far better to check on oil temperature ONLY. Still not for meat temperature.
Turkey is moist and tender at breast temp of 165 deg F, but tough and stringy at 175 deg and higher. That's a circular dial distance of only about 1/8th of an inch on this unit. Worse, beef internal temp range is about 124 deg F. to 132 deg - from rare to beyond-medium. The great news is that Amazon sells digital remote thermometers (plus also cheap replacement probes) that are far more logical for monitoring meat temps. In a fryer basket, the turkey breast is fairly close to the surface of the oil, so it is easy to insert a digital thermometer probe. Just be sure to wear a suitable safety glove, which you must have anyway when deep frying. [I actually use a digital remote Amazon thermometer to check fryer oil temp as well as smoker temp, as back-up to a round analog thermometer. Also stock spare probes).
